Product Engineering requests an incremental allocation for the Meridian sensor refresh, covering tooling, two additional test rigs, and contractor support through the fiscal year. The request equals roughly six percent of the approved engineering budget and is offset partly by deferring the Halloway facility repaint. Without approval, the refresh slips two quarters and we lose the autumn trade window. Finance has validated the figures. The confidential note appended below outlines the commercial rationale in full.

confidential, kajof-tahof: The pricing group signed off on a budget of $491.8 million for Project Casvan.

## Deployment

So you're shipping Mergeling, our customer-record dedup service. Heads up: it's stateful during a run, so don't autoscale mid-batch or you'll get half-merged records and a sad on-call rotation. Deploy to the Fennwick cluster, one replica per region, and let the coordinator elect a leader. Smoke-test with the sample dataset first — matching thresholds are aggressive by default and will happily merge cousins into one person. Before starting your first run, set the service configuration exactly as shown below.

config for bahop-fajep:
DRUATH_PIN=4501
DRUATH_TENANT=briwyn
DRUATH_METRICS_HOST=metrics.druath.brasksoft.test
DRUATH_SEAL=seal_7d2e069d
DRUATH_STANDBY_TEAM=olieth

Subject: Scanner integration — on-call notes

Quick context before the sync: the Quillport barcode scanner integration is now live in all three warehouses. Most pages you'll get are timeout retries from the handheld units; they self-recover, so only escalate if failures persist past ten minutes. Firmware mismatches are the other common cause. The troubleshooting matrix and escalation thresholds are kept on the integration page.

runbook for tafof-yawif: https://confluence.tolvaqsys.internal/display/display/browse/pages/7be3